Leads all aspects of RGA's global Digital Workplace, Workforce Collaboration Services, Workstation Engineering, and Everyday AI functions. Oversees teams responsible for Email & Messaging, Workforce Collaboration Services, End User Computing, Corporate Mobility, Collaboration Platforms, Digital Employee Experience, and AI-powered workplace services. Establishes strategic direction, operating models, organizational capabilities, and performance metrics that enable a modern, intelligent, and experience-driven workplace. Drives enterprise productivity, collaboration, workforce engagement, and AI adoption through integrated digital workplace experiences. Participates in the development of policies, standards, governance, controls, and best practices while supporting IT business planning, budgeting, workforce planning, and strategic investment decisions.
